Things to consider
Higher = more presentNo sexual content is present in the story.
There is no violence depicted in the narrative.
No profanity is used by the characters.
No blasphemous language is present.
No substance abuse is depicted.
No themes of suicide or self-harm are included.
The story is lighthearted and humorous.
A magical burp is the central fantastical element.
No LGBTQ+ themes are present.
The worldview is focused on fairy tales and humor.
No negative portrayals of God or Christians are present.
Virtues to celebrate
Higher = stronger presenceThe princess shows some resilience in dealing with her problem.
No explicit Christian faith elements are present.
Family relationships are a minor theme.
No themes of grace or repentance are present.
